Why These Are the Top Windows Contractors in Cory

** The window service market in and around Cory, Colorado, is characterized by a small number of specialized, high-quality regional contractors rather than a high volume of competition. Due to Cory's rural nature, homeowners typically rely on providers from larger nearby hubs like Montrose (approximately a 30-minute drive). The market focuses heavily on durability and energy efficiency to withstand the region's significant seasonal shifts, including cold winters and sunny, warm summers. Common services include replacing old, single-pane windows with modern, double-pane, Low-E glass units to reduce heating costs and improve comfort. Pricing is generally in line with regional averages, with a typical full-window replacement project for a home ranging from $8,000 to $20,000, depending on the window quality, home size, and customization required. 1How does Cory's high-desert climate affect my choice of replacement windows?

Cory's climate features hot summers, cold winters, and significant temperature swings, making energy efficiency paramount. We strongly recommend windows with a low U-factor and low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) to keep heat in during winter and reflect solar heat in summer. Double-pane, Low-E argon-filled windows are the standard recommendation here to combat the local weather extremes and reduce energy bills year-round.

2What is the typical cost range for a full home window replacement in Cory, and what factors influence the price?

For a typical single-family home in Cory, a full replacement can range from $8,000 to $20,000+, with the average project falling between $12,000-$16,000. Key cost factors include the number/size of windows, the material (vinyl, fiberglass, or wood), the energy efficiency rating, and the complexity of installation in your specific home's structure. Local material transport costs to our more rural area can also slightly influence the final price compared to larger Colorado cities.

4When is the best time of year to schedule window installation in Cory?

While installation can be performed year-round, the ideal windows are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October). These periods offer mild temperatures for the installation crew and allow for proper sealing of materials. Scheduling well in advance for these popular times is crucial. Winter installations are possible but require special precautions for cold-weather sealing and may face weather delays.

5What should I look for when choosing a window installation contractor in the Cory area?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have verifiable local references in Cory or nearby Delta County. Look for specific experience with Colorado's energy codes and the high-wind conditions common in our region. A trustworthy provider will offer a detailed, in-home estimate (not just a phone quote), provide clear warranty information on both product and labor, and be transparent about their project timeline.
